Minara Masjid: A Serene Oasis of Faith in Mumbai

Minara Masjid, a prominent mosque located in the heart of Mumbai, is a captivating blend of spiritual tranquility and architectural beauty. Known for its stunning facade and intricate details, this mosque attracts both worshippers and curious tourists alike. The mosque's design features ornate minarets and elegant arches, making it a remarkable sight against the urban backdrop of the city. Visitors are welcomed to appreciate the serene atmosphere, which offers a rare escape from the bustling streets of Mumbai. The mosque is open daily from early morning until noon, allowing ample time for visitors to experience its peaceful ambiance during the morning prayers. While exploring Minara Masjid, tourists can take a moment to observe the local traditions and rituals that unfold within its walls, providing a unique glimpse into the spiritual life of the city. The surrounding area is bustling with life, offering a chance to indulge in local street food and vibrant marketplaces, making it an ideal stop in any tourist's itinerary. The mosque also serves as a cultural hub, where visitors can learn about Islamic architecture and the historical significance of the site. When visiting, it’s important to dress modestly and respect the customs observed within the mosque. Photography is typically allowed, but it's advisable to ask for permission in certain areas to ensure reverence for the sacredness of the space. Minara Masjid is not just a religious site; it is a testament to Mumbai's rich tapestry of cultures and faith, making it a must-see destination for anyone exploring this vibrant city.

Getting There

  • Local Train

    If you are starting from CST (Chhatrapati Shivaji Maharaj Terminus), board a local train on the Central Line towards Kalyan. Get down at Byculla Station. Once you exit the station, take a left and walk towards the Byculla Bridge.

  • Walking

    From Byculla Station, walk straight towards the Byculla Bridge. Cross the bridge, and continue straight until you reach the junction where you will see a large intersection. Here, take a right onto Mohammed Ali Road.

  • Walking

    Continue walking along Mohammed Ali Road for about 1 kilometer. You will pass several shops and eateries along the way. Keep an eye out for the Minara Masjid, which will be on your left at number 22, just before you reach the junction with Pydhonie Street.

  • Landmark Navigation

    As you approach Minara Masjid, look for the large green dome that is a distinctive feature of the mosque. The area can be bustling, so be aware of your surroundings as you navigate through the crowd.
